Europe Pays Tributes as Biden Withdraws from Presidential Race

Tributes poured in from world leaders across Europe for Joe Biden after he announced his decision to not run for another term as President of the United States and endorsed Vice President Kamala Harris as his successor.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y thanked Biden for his unwavering support following the Russian invasion, while German Chancellor Olaf Scholz admired his decision and leadership. Poland’s Prime Minister Donald Tusk praised Biden for making difficult decisions that have made the world safer, and UK Prime Minister Keir Starmer respected Biden’s decision to put the American people first.

Germany’s Chancellor Olaf Scholz highlighted Biden’s friendship and dedication to strong transatlantic cooperation, while Spain’s Prime Minister Pedro Sánchez commended Biden’s commitment to democracy and freedom. Kamala Harris expressed her gratitude for Biden’s extraordinary leadership and welcomed his endorsement for her presidential bid. Former President Barack Obama lauded Biden as one of America’s most consequential leaders, and former House Speaker Nancy Pelosi expressed her love and gratitude towards Biden’s greatness and goodness.

The decision made by Biden has sparked discussions about the future of US-Ukraine relations, as Biden has been a key financial and military supporter of Ukraine against Russian aggression. Concerns linger about potential changes in policy under a different administration, especially if President Donald Trump wins the upcoming election in November. Biden’s track record of tough decisions and unwavering support for global alliances has been widely acknowledged by leaders worldwide, emphasizing the impact of his presidency on international relations.

Despite Biden’s decision not to seek reelection, world leaders from Europe continue to express appreciation for his leadership and dedication to democratic values. The importance of strong transatlantic ties and NATO cooperation has been emphasized, with leaders commending Biden for his role in maintaining these alliances. As Biden prepares to address the nation about his decision, the global response indicates the respect and admiration he has garnered during his presidency.

In the aftermath of Biden’s announcement, the political landscape both domestically and internationally is set to shift, as attention turns towards the upcoming presidential election. With Biden’s endorsement of Kamala Harris, the focus is now on her as a potential candidate for the presidency. The impact of Biden’s decision on the future of the Democratic Party, as well as US foreign policy, remains to be seen. As world leaders reflect on Biden’s legacy, his leadership and commitment to democracy continue to be lauded across the globe.
